Output d2dffd5b4eb89c22fb0892369eaea188a91b6472015247ebcd3cabe51f0cd732:1

value
40062520
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ddda6f2c65e6570dffa5776439b734476430e45fdbe84278be51ac777e2e6c2e
address
bc1pmhdx7tr9uetsmla9wajrnde5gajrpezlm05yy7972xk8wl3wdshqslgeqf
transaction
d2dffd5b4eb89c22fb0892369eaea188a91b6472015247ebcd3cabe51f0cd732
confirmations
1879
spent
true